| @@ -62,7 +62,7 @@ echo '</div> | |||||
| //skripts, kurš iveidos tabulas iekš dBase | //skripts, kurš iveidos tabulas iekš dBase | ||||
| //saglabājam DB | //saglabājam DB | ||||
| //Tabula priekš lietotajiem. Nedzēsiet | //Tabula priekš lietotajiem. Nedzēsiet | ||||
| $tabulausers="CREATE TABLE IF NOT EXISTS tbUsers ( | |||||
| $tabulausers="CREATE TABLE IF NOT EXISTS tbLietotaji ( | |||||
| UsrID int(25) NOT NULL AUTO_INCREMENT, | UsrID int(25) NOT NULL AUTO_INCREMENT, | ||||
| UsrMail text COLLATE utf8_bin NOT NULL, | UsrMail text COLLATE utf8_bin NOT NULL, | ||||
| UsrParole text COLLATE utf8_bin NOT NULL, | UsrParole text COLLATE utf8_bin NOT NULL, | ||||
| @@ -71,73 +71,31 @@ echo '</div> | |||||
| PRIMARY KEY (UsrID) | PRIMARY KEY (UsrID) | ||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||||
| //PIEVIENOJIET KODU SAVU TABULU IZVEIDEI! | //PIEVIENOJIET KODU SAVU TABULU IZVEIDEI! | ||||
| $tabulaamats = "CREATE TABLE IF NOT EXISTS tbAmats ( | |||||
| AID int(5) NOT NULL AUTO_INCREMENT, | |||||
| AmatsNos text COLLATE utf8_bin NOT NULL, | |||||
| PRIMARY KEY (AID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;" ; | |||||
| $tabulacv = "CREATE TABLE IF NOT EXISTS tbCV ( | |||||
| CID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PERSID int(5) NOT NULL, | |||||
| CVFails text COLLATE utf8_bin NOT NULL, | |||||
| CVDatums tim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, | |||||
| CVLabs int(11) NOT NULL DEFAULT 1, | |||||
| CVSlikts int(11) NOT NULL DEFAULT 0, | |||||
| CVDzests int(11) NOT NULL DEFAULT 0, | |||||
| PRIMARY KEY (CID) | |||||
| $tabularezervacija="CREATE TABLE IF NOT EXISTS tbRezervacija ( | |||||
| RezID int(5) NOT NULL AUTO_INCREMENT, | |||||
| KlientaRezID int(5) NOT NULL, | |||||
| PakalpRezID int(5) NOT NULL, | |||||
| RezPiezime text COLLATE utf8_bin, | |||||
| RezDatums text NOT NULL, | |||||
| RezApstiprinats int(2) NOT NULL DEFAULT 0, | |||||
| RezAtcelts int(2) NOT NULL DEFAULT 0, | |||||
| RezNoticis int(2) NOT NULL DEFAULT 0, | |||||
| PRIMARY KEY (RezID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||||
| $tabulacvtag="CREATE TABLE IF NOT EXISTS tbCVTAG ( | |||||
| CTID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PersonasID int(5) NOT NULL, | |||||
| CVID int(5) NOT NULL, | |||||
| TAGID int(5) NOT NULL, | |||||
| PRIMARY KEY (CTID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| |||||
| $tabulaintervija="CREATE TABLE IF NOT EXISTS tbIntervija ( | |||||
| IntID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PERSID text COLLATE utf8_bin NOT NULL, | |||||
| IntDatums text COLLATE utf8_bin NOT NULL, | |||||
| IntKomentars text COLLATE utf8_bin, | |||||
| IntRezultats text COLLATE utf8_bin, | |||||
| AMATSID text COLLATE utf8_bin NOT NULL, | |||||
| IntAtbildet int(11) NOT NULL DEFAULT 0, | |||||
| IntIntervetajs text COLLATE utf8_bin NOT NULL, | |||||
| PRIMARY KEY (IntID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| |||||
| $tabulakomentars="CREATE TABLE IF NOT EXISTS tbKomentars ( | |||||
| PiezID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PersonasID int(5) NOT NULL, | |||||
| Piezime text COLLATE utf8_bin NOT NULL, | |||||
| PiezDatums tim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, | |||||
| PiezDzesta int(2) NOT NULL DEFAULT 0, | |||||
| PRIMARY KEY (PiezID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| |||||
| $tabulapersamats="CREATE TABLE IF NOT EXISTS tbPersAmats ( | |||||
| PAID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PersID int(5) NOT NULL, | |||||
| AmatID int(5) NOT NULL, | |||||
| PRIMARY KEY (PAID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| |||||
| $tabulapersonas="CREATE TABLE IF NOT EXISTS tbPersonas ( | |||||
| PID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PersVards text COLLATE utf8_bin NOT NULL, | |||||
| PersUzvards text COLLATE utf8_bin NOT NULL, | |||||
| PersGads text COLLATE utf8_bin NOT NULL, | |||||
| PersEpasts text COLLATE utf8_bin NOT NULL, | |||||
| PersTel text COLLATE utf8_bin NOT NULL, | |||||
| PersPilseta text COLLATE utf8_bin NOT NULL, | |||||
| PersIela text COLLATE utf8_bin NOT NULL, | |||||
| PersPienemts int(11) NOT NULL DEFAULT 0, | |||||
| PersNoraidits int(11) NOT NULL DEFAULT 0, | |||||
| PersPievienots int(11) NOT NULL DEFAULT 0, | |||||
| PersBlacklist int(11) NOT NULL DEFAULT 0, | |||||
| PRIMARY KEY (PID) | |||||
| $tabulapakalpojumi="CREATE TABLE IF NOT EXISTS tbPakalpojumi ( | |||||
| PakID int(5) NOT NULL AUTO_INCREMENT, | |||||
| PakNosaukums TEXT NOT NULL, | |||||
| PakIlgums int(5) NOT NULL, | |||||
| PakPieejams int(2) NOT NULL DEFAULT 1, | |||||
| PRIMARY KEY (PakID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||||
| $tabulatag="CREATE TABLE IF NOT EXISTS tbTag ( | |||||
| TID int(5) NOT NULL AUTO_INCREMENT, | |||||
| TagName text COLLATE utf8_bin NOT NULL, | |||||
| PRIMARY KEY (TID) | |||||
| $tabulaklienti="CREATE TABLE IF NOT EXISTS tbKlienti ( | |||||
| KlientaID int(5) NOT NULL AUTO_INCREMENT, | |||||
| KlientaVards text COLLATE utf8_bin NOT NULL, | |||||
| KlientaUzvards text COLLATE utf8_bin NOT NULL, | |||||
| KlientaEpasts text COLLATE utf8_bin NOT NULL, | |||||
| KlientaTel text COLLATE utf8_bin NOT NULL, | |||||
| PRIMARY KEY (KlientaID) | |||||
| 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COLLATE=utf8_bin AUTO_INCREMENT=1;"; | ||||
| //MySQL VAICĀJUMU IZPILDEI! Skatīt video. Ierakstiet savu vaicājumu izpildi. Improvise Adapt Overcome!!! | //MySQL VAICĀJUMU IZPILDEI! Skatīt video. Ierakstiet savu vaicājumu izpildi. Improvise Adapt Overcome!!! | ||||
| @@ -146,7 +104,7 @@ echo '</div> | |||||
| $parolehash=password_hash($parole, PASSWORD_DEFAULT); | $parolehash=password_hash($parole, PASSWORD_DEFAULT); | ||||
| $epasts=mysqli_real_escape_string($conn1, $_POST['epasts']); | $epasts=mysqli_real_escape_string($conn1, $_POST['epasts']); | ||||
| //Sagatavojam vaicājumu 1. lietotāja izveidei (aizpidlīts formā) | //Sagatavojam vaicājumu 1. lietotāja izveidei (aizpidlīts formā) | ||||
| $insusr="INSERT INTO tbUsers (UsrMail,UsrParole,UsrAdmin) VALUES ('$epasts','$parolehash',1)"; | |||||
| $insusr="INSERT INTO tbLietotaji (UsrMail,UsrParole,UsrAdmin) VALUES ('$epasts','$parolehash',1)"; | |||||
| /*Pārbaudam, vai varam izveidot savienojumu ar SQL serveri un vai varam izveidot 1. tabulu. | /*Pārbaudam, vai varam izveidot savienojumu ar SQL serveri un vai varam izveidot 1. tabulu. | ||||
| Ja varam, tad turpinam instalācijas gaitu, ja nē, izvadam kļūdu! | Ja varam, tad turpinam instalācijas gaitu, ja nē, izvadam kļūdu! | ||||
| */ | */ | ||||
| @@ -178,13 +136,9 @@ echo '</div> | |||||
| file_put_contents($jaunsFails, $failaSaturs); | file_put_contents($jaunsFails, $failaSaturs); | ||||
| //Izpildām visus SQL vaicājumus, lai izveidotu un saglabātu datus datubāzē | //Izpildām visus SQL vaicājumus, lai izveidotu un saglabātu datus datubāzē | ||||
| mysqli_query($conn1,$insusr); | mysqli_query($conn1,$insusr); | ||||
| mysqli_query($conn1,$tabulacv); | |||||
| mysqli_query($conn1,$tabulacvtag); | |||||
| mysqli_query($conn1,$tabulaintervija); | |||||
| mysqli_query($conn1,$tabulakomentars); | |||||
| mysqli_query($conn1,$tabulapersamats); | |||||
| mysqli_query($conn1,$tabulapersonas); | |||||
| mysqli_query($conn1,$tabulatag); | |||||
| mysqli_query($conn1,$tabulaklienti); | |||||
| mysqli_query($conn1,$tabulapakalpojumi); | |||||
| mysqli_query($conn,$tabularezervacija); | |||||
| //Paziņojam, ka instalācija veiksmīga | //Paziņojam, ka instalācija veiksmīga | ||||
| echo '<h2>Instalācija ir veiksmīga! <a href=index.php>Sākums</a></h2>'; | echo '<h2>Instalācija ir veiksmīga! <a href=index.php>Sākums</a></h2>'; | ||||
Powered by TurnKey Linux.